Artistic License (2023)
Musical Colors on Display…start with piano, add strings & orchestra, and expand into “Infinite” possibilities… Instrumental soundtracks here spring forth from a number of unusual places – Olympic triumphs, introspective journeys, even a techno-rock-orchestral score (“Alternate Universes”) that was inspired from a novel by best-selling author Brian Freeman (“Infinite”). All with the sophisticated, clever layers that are part of Steve DeDoes’ musical craft.

Single Release: “Magic In The Night” (2024 update to 90’s TV Theme)
This song was originally composed by Steve DeDoes (with Kerstin Allvin) in the late 1980’s. It was subsequently recorded by Moloney Productions and used in live shows worldwide – it then enjoyed a connection with the late magician Doug Henning, to be employed in a video collection of his television specials. This original version of the song received a Billboard Magazine award in 1993.
DeDoes has subsequently re-written the lyrics, and releases an exciting new version here in a guitar-driven production that features vocals by Sue Gillis and Laura Lyons.

A Special Single Release: “Lullabye For Lisa”, from Bluetopia
A musical love letter. The layers of this song – the transparencies, the complexities…all culminate in a statement of pure intimacy. The “space between the notes” (a Debussy quote) is part of the great performance, as Steve’s quartet (with saxophonist Pete Kahn, bassist David Stearns, and percussionist David Taylor) works improvisational magic with this beautiful ballad. This song, and this careful rendering of it, wonderfully convey the intangibles that occur over a lifelong relationship.
